== Multiplayer ==
For several years most online players used the MS-DOS version in combination with [http://www.kali.net/ Kali].<ref>[http://masteroforion2.blogspot.com/2004/02/moo2-online.html MOO2 online] at masteroforion2.blogspot.com</ref><ref>[http://www.pixelexiq.com/moo2/DOSSetup.asp Setting up MOO2 for Multiplayer] at Kali MOO2 League</ref> New operating systems (e.g. Windows 2000, XP and Vista) and improved hardware (e.g. more than 512MB RAM) made further adjustments necessary in order to use the MS-DOS version.<ref>[http://www.masteroforion2.com/4381/gamesetup/index.htm#trouble Trouble Shooting Guide] at www.masteroforion2.com</ref>


[[DOSBox]], in combination with the #MOO2 IRC channel on [http://www.quakenet.org/ Quakenet], is now the most popular solution for MOO II online games, because it supports [http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IPX/SPX IPX] (since DOSBox version 0.65) and also allows Windows users to play against users of other operating systems (e.g. Linux, Mac OS).<ref name="Moo2BlogspotDosBox">[http://masteroforion2.blogspot.com/2006/05/dosbox-guide.html DosBox Guide] at masteroforion2.blogspot.com</ref>
